Job Title: Executive PA / Office Manager 60,000 Central London
Working Pattern: Full-time | Office-based (no remote days except Friday afternoons)
We are seeking an experienced and highly capable Executive PA / Office Manager to provide professional support to a respected leadership team and ensure the smooth, efficient operation of a high-spec Central London office.
This is a key role in maintaining operational excellence across a multi-use site, which includes client meeting rooms, an on-site gym, and private residential quarters. You will combine first-class administrative skills with the ability to manage facilities, vendors, and day-to-day office functions to the highest standard.
Key Responsibilities
Office & Facilities Management
* Oversee all aspects of a multi-use property, including communal areas, gym, and tenant office.
* Manage stock, supplies, catering, and daily housekeeping.
* Serve as the main contact for repairs, contractors, and building service providers.
Executive & Team Support
* Provide Executive Assistant support to the partners, including diary management, travel arrangements, and expenses.
* Welcome guests, prepare meeting spaces, and ensure a professional front-of-house experience.
* Organise internal events, offsites, and team activities.
Liaison & Vendor Management
* Maintain relationships with suppliers, advisers, and service providers.
* Act as the primary contact for the tenant office, ensuring effective communication and support.
Person Specification
* Significant experience as an Executive Assistant or Office Manager in a professional, fast-paced environment.
* Exceptional organisational and communication skills.
* Discreet, proactive, and service-driven approach.
* Comfortable managing both operational and executive support responsibilities.
Benefits
* 60,000 salary
* Private healthcare
* Competitive employer pension contribution
